
At LGM Engineering we operate a Amada ENSIS fibre laser, supported by an AS-LUL automated loading and unloading tower, allowing us to deliver fast, repeatable, and highly accurate laser cutting across a wide range of materials and thicknesses.
The ENSIS platform is known for its variable beam control, which automatically adapts the laser beam profile to suit material type and thickness. This enables clean, high-quality cutting across thin sheet and thicker plate without constant manual intervention, improving edge quality, consistency, and throughput.
Our AS-LUL automation tower allows lights-out operation, with automated sheet handling and part unloading. This reduces handling time, minimises human error, and ensures consistent production even on longer or repeat-run jobs. The result is faster turnaround, reliable repeatability, and competitive pricing for both one-off prototypes and production batches.
